Title:
FREQUENCY SHIFTER AND OPTICAL DISPLACEMENT MEASURING EQUIPMENT USING THE SAME

Abstract:

PURPOSE: To detect information on the speed of a moving object with high accuracy by setting the period of an impression voltage and the thickness of an electrooptical element at values at which the resonance of the element is prevented.
CONSTITUTION: The thickness (d) of electrooptical elements 10a and 10b and a period TS of serrodyne driving thereof are set as follows. The elements 10a and 10b have a Pockels effect and also a piezoelectric effect. Shapes thereof are changed at the time of a fall of a sawtooth wave and the vibration thereof resonates with the period TS. The resonance becomes minimum and a high frequency decreases at the time of TS=2d/v×(n+1/2) when an acoustic velocity in the direction of voltage impression of the elements 10a and 10b is denoted by (v) and (n) is an integer. By selecting the driving period TS of the elements 10a and 10b in this way, a frequency shifter is made stable and highly accurate information on a speed is obtained.
